Description
Electrophysiology Tech - Travel/Contract
Location: Augusta, Georgia
Contract Length: 12 weeks
Job Overview
- Specialty: Radiology / Cardiology (EP Tech for EP Lab)
- Patient Population: Adults to Geriatrics
- Shift: Day shift, 4 days per week, 10-hour shifts (7:00 AM - 5:30 PM)
- Typical Census: 2 procedure rooms, 1:5 tech-to-patient ratio, 8-12 patients per day
- Unit Systems: Epic, Pyxis
- Scrub color provided by facility
- Weekend Schedule: Every other weekend
- Floating: Rare but possible within facility and scope of practice
- Call Requirements: Yes; no weekend call but may need to stay past shift hours if on call that day
- Holiday Work: Expected to work major holidays if they fall during assignment (see list below)
- Required to start within 7 days of offer (RTO)
- Orientation hours vary by contract length

Required Qualifications
- Minimum 1 year of experience as an Electrophysiology Technician within the last year
- Certifications:
- BLS (Basic Life Support)
- ACLS (Advanced Cardiac Life Support)
- ARRT (R) or CCI certification
Compliance & Documentation Requirements
- Background Check: Must be completed within 30 days prior to start, including criminal, sex offender, education verification, and others
- Education Verification: Degree verification required; can be pending at start with proof of processing
- Physical Exam: Required within 12 months prior to start
- Drug Screen: Negative 10-panel drug screen within 60 days prior to start (includes amphetamines, benzodiazepines, cocaine, opiates, THC, etc.)
- Immunizations & Health:
- TB test or chest X-ray within 12 months (with TB questionnaire updated annually)
- MMR (Measles, Mumps, Rubella) - 2 vaccines or positive titer with boosters if needed
- Varicella - 2 vaccines or positive titer with boosters if needed
- Hepatitis B surface antibody titer or signed declination
- Flu vaccine or declination required during flu season (Nov 1 - Mar 31)
- TDAP highly recommended but not required
- Color Blind Testing: Required; alternative assessment available if needed
- Competency Exams: Required for dysrhythmia/EKG and medication/pharmacology competency
- Skills Checklist: Must be updated within 12 months
- Work History Verification: Verification of most recent employer required; can be pending at start with proof of processing
- References: Two clinical references required

About Augusta, GA
As a Travel Electrophysiology Technician in Augusta, GA here's what you should know:Cost of Living
- The cost of living in Augusta, GA is lower than the national average, making it an affordable place to live.
- Wages generally match up with the lower cost of living.
Weather
- Augusta experiences hot and humid summers with average highs around 92°F and mild winters with average lows around 35°F.
Furnished Housing
- Short term rentals and furnished housing options are available in Augusta, GA and can be relatively easy to find, especially in popular areas.
Transportation
- Augusta is car-friendly with easy access to major highways.
- Public transportation options are available but may be limited compared to larger cities.
Demographics
- Augusta has a diverse population with a wide age range.
- Common health issues may include allergies due to the pollen in the area.
- There is a growing population of travel nurses in Augusta.
Things to Do
- Augusta offers a variety of restaurants, including Southern cuisine and international dining options.
- The city has a vibrant arts and music scene, with opportunities to enjoy live performances.
- Sports enthusiasts can enjoy golf, as Augusta is home to the prestigious Masters Tournament.
- Outdoor activities such as hiking, boating, and fishing are popular due to the city's proximity to the Savannah River and nearby parks.
